SOUTH KAWISHIWI R ABV WHITE IRON LAKE NR ELY, MN (05126210) is a real-time river monitoring station on the SOUTH KAWISHIWI RIVER in MN, operated by the U.S. Geological Survey. Riverbot tracks its river conditions, including water level, and streamflow and keeps recent, datum-labelled water-level history for anglers. 16 fish species are associated with this station in public fish records.

Fish recorded near this station
Community observations nearbySouth Kawishiwi R Abv White Iron Lake Nr Ely, Mn has 16 fish species documented via iNaturalist research-grade observations within 10 km. These community-sourced records indicate fish presence in the vicinity.
Species include: Rock Bass (Ambloplites rupestris), White Sucker (Catostomus commersonii), Northern Pike (Esox lucius), Common Sunfishes (Lepomis), Bluegill (Lepomis macrochirus), and 11 others.
- Rock Bass Ambloplites rupestris
- White Sucker Catostomus commersonii
- Northern Pike Esox lucius
- Common Sunfishes Lepomis
- Bluegill Lepomis macrochirus
- Common Shiner Luxilus cornutus
- Smallmouth Bass Micropterus dolomieu
- Shorthead Redhorse Moxostoma macrolepidotum
- Tadpole Madtom Noturus gyrinus
- Rainbow Trout Oncorhynchus mykiss
- Yellow Perch Perca flavescens
- Common Logperch Percina caprodes
- Trout-Perch Percopsis omiscomaycus
- Fathead Minnow Pimephales promelas
- Brook Trout Salvelinus fontinalis
- Walleye Sander vitreus
